Say I'm up $500 net on all of my trades, and want to lock in $200 across the "basket", what should I do? I can't set the Shirt-Protect to a positive number, so would it be possible to allow that in the code?Ignored
DislikedHi, I think you can set the basket jump option at $300 and set your basket break even to $200 and set add break even to jump option to true to achieve that now..Ignored
